Launched in 2016, this content business is one of the first and most comprehensive blogs in the Natural Motherhood space. It features articles on motherhood, baby care, baby gear, pregnancy, and postpartum from a natural and nontoxic perspective, a growing concern among new and existing mothers. The largest source of revenue is from affiliate marketing at 70%, with display ads bringing in 17% and the remaining 13% from drop-ship product sales.

The current owner chose to start this blog as a way to share her own experiences as a new mother. It has since become a recognized authority in the Nontoxic Parenting/Living space. The business also has a strong social media presence with 11K followers on Facebook, 98K members of the Facebook group, 18K followers on Instagram, and 681K monthly views on Pinterest. There are currently no PPC campaigns, so the majority of traffic comes from organic search and social media.

One certain path to growth is to publish more articles, as additional content will bring more traffic to the site. With an email list of over 48,000, utilizing this list in structured campaigns would also help to boost traffic. The Shopify site and Amazon store are currently the smallest sources of revenue and could become more profitable by adding more products that can be drop-shipped from the vendors. Most attention to social media has been on the Facebook group, as it has the largest quantity of members, so expanding that focus to other platforms would help build traffic.

The current owner spends about 5–7 hours per week operating the business. With no physical inventory, operations can take place anywhere. Freelance writers can be utilized to provide the content, making it unnecessary to have specific knowledge in this field. The owner is committed to a smooth transition and will happily provide training and support.
